IBM, Toyota, and many other firms are breaking through traditional interview barriers and turning to extraviewing--delving into the psyche, personality, and flexibility of potential employees to hire the best. Bell shows how techniques such as the experiential interview, the expressive interview, the environmental interview, personality tests, games, social tests, and even handwriting analysis can be used to gain insight into the behavior, traits, and work styles of potential employees.
